PM Chairs High Level Security Meet

Prime Minister Manmohan Singh chaired a high-level national security meeting at his residence on Saturday. On the agenda was the situation arising out of intelligence alerts of possible terror threats to the coastal parts of Maharashtra and Goa.

The meeting, attended by some of the security officials in the country, lasted for over two-and-a-half hour’s and is reported to have also taken up the security situation in Jammu and Kashmir, where the Amarnath Yatra is currently underway.

Finance Minister Pranab Mukherjee, Defence Minister AK Antony, Home Minister P Chidambaram, National Security Advisor MK Narayanan and new Foreign Secretary Nirupama Rao attended the meeting.

The three service chiefs were also present on the occasion.
